The 2024 Biology exam format will be: Multiple Choice - 50% of your score. 60 questions in 1 hour 30 minutes. Individual questions. Sets of questions with 4-5 questions per set. Free Response - 50% of your score. 6 Questions in 1 hour 30 Minutes. 2 long questions worth 8-10 points each. Learn all about the AP Macroeconomics exam! Schachter-Singer Theory. , or Schachter 2 Factor Theory, brings cognition into emotion. When one senses physiological arousal, one does a cognitive appraisal by scanning their environment in order to determine the emotion that one is feeling. Irrigation. uses water in several organized ways to promote healthy and efficient crop growth. Get immediate feedback and detailed explanations for every practice question.The iris is a colored muscle that constricts (gets smaller) or dilates (gets larger) based on light . The more light exposure, the more the pupil constricts. 3. Behind the pupil is the lens. It focuses incoming light onto the retina as an upside-down image and changes the shape of light.
